Calcium helps with the construction of your bones. You must also have a good amount of vitamin D to help your body absorb calcium. You can give yourself vitamin D through foods, take a supplement or eat a fortified food. Each of these can help ensure your body will absorb calcium.

Any supplement that has fat needs to be taken when you eat, so plan to take it around the time you eat. Vitamin E is one great example of this. Also, the food should be somewhat fatty.

Iron is the key mineral to helping build healthy red blood cells. The red blood cells are required to carry oxygen to every part of your body. Women require more iron than men. This is why a woman should choose a multivitamin for women. If you are very tired, or your breathing is labored, you may need more iron.

Manganese is a nutrient that you should consider. It is good for your bones and helps you heal from injuries. It is also used to speed up how the body metabolizes proteins and carbohydrates. This can be found in whole grains, almonds, and black and green teas. You can purchase the supplement at retail stores, as well.

Vitamin B12 does not always absorb well as you get older. You can eat lots, but none actually makes it to your cells. It’s a good idea to have a doctor test your B12 levels so that you can figure out whether or not you need to get shots.

Take calcium carbonate with food in order to boost bone health. You can take calcium citrate with water, but not calcium carbonate. If you don’t, the supplement will not be fully absorbed and wasted.
